A sector of a circle is shown below. The sector has an area of $60 \pi.$ What is the radius of the circle?
Recall the following formula:
The area of a sector with radius r and central angle θ∘ is θ360⋅πr2.
Using the formula, we have
83360⋅πr2=60π
This means
r2=360⋅6083=2160083
r=√2160083≈16.13
